About

Chen Lin is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cancer Research and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Chen Lin has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 348 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Molecular Biology, 10 papers in Cancer Research and 3 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Chen Lin's work include MicroRNA in disease regulation (8 papers),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(6 papers) and Circular RNAs in diseases (5 papers). Chen Lin is often cited by papers focused on MicroRNA in disease regulation (8 papers),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(6 papers) and Circular RNAs in diseases (5 papers). Chen Lin coll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Sweden. Chen Lin's co-authors include Fei Huang, Yajing Zhang, Yonghua Shi, Qiaozhi Li, Mingzhu Huang, Weiwei Jiang, Zhenhua Wu, Weijian Guo, Xin Liu and Chenchen Liu and has published in prestigious journals such as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ications, Cancer Letters and World Journal of Gastroenterology.
